Metis Art is partnering with Museum MACAN to support the commissioning of the performance artwork Sirkus di Tanah Pengasingan: Oyong-oyong Ayang-ayang (Shadows from the Land of Exiles) by Jumaadi and the Shadow Factory as part of the Voice Against Reason group exhibition. The course fees for our very first Tetrad programme in Jakarta will be entirely donated to the development of the performance. 

A: The Broad Strokes of Art History

As the Metis maxim goes, history is everything to the value of art. From ancient art to modernism and global contemporary art, we trace how major art movements were impacted by simultaneous developments in history, technology, philosophy and culture.

Your Destination:
Gain an in-depth understanding of the historical contexts that scaffold the development of art and its value in the world today. Draw cogent links between art and global or regional histories, society, and the cultures it emerges from.

B: The Art Ecosystem

Who’s who? Galleries, museums, non-profits, art fairs and auction houses fulfil both conflicting and complementary roles that shape the growth of artists’ careers. We make sense of their complex interactions that drive the world of contemporary art.

Your Destination:
Become acquainted with who key industry actors are, their roles in the art ecosystem, and determine their level of influence in how they define an artist’s career. Know how to evaluate artists’ CVs, which are often determinants of their works’ prices.

C: Value, Price and Investments

Now, let’s talk business. We get to grips with what value really means according to both art theorists and dealers — two sides of the same coin. We penetrate the often opaque ebbs and flows of the art market.

Your Destination:
Grasp what it means to be an emerging, mid-career, or blue chip artist, and identify the invisible primary and secondary market mechanisms that promote their value. See through the dark matter of art investments.
